Majdūlīyah
Majdūlīyah is a locality in Quneitra Governorate, Syria and has an elevation of 821 metres. Majdūlīyah is situated nearby to the village Kammuniyah, as well as near the locality Arāḑī al Khamīsah.Places in the Area

Beer Ajam

Beer Ajam is a Syrian Circassian village in the Quneitra Governorate in the Golan Heights. It has been inhabited for about 150 years. Its first houses were built in 1872. Beer Ajam is situated 5 km southwest of Majdūlīyah.
Bereiqa

Bariqa is a village in southwestern Syria, administratively part of the Quneitra Governorate, south of Quneitra, in the Syrian-controlled portion of the Golan Heights. Bereiqa is situated 6 km southwest of Majdūlīyah.
